Best cities to live in texas - Population (as of April 1, 2020): 138,486. Job Growth 2021-2022: 4.1%. Unemployment Rate: 3.5%. Thanks to a growing number of jobs and a low unemployment rate, Waco is one of the best places to live in Texas. Home to Baylor University, Waco reports strong employment numbers in higher education.

Its proximity to the Atlantic Ocean, some great state parks, and bigger cities along the eastern seaboard make it an …Named for Frank P. Killeen, an employee of the Santa Fe Railroad in the late 1800s, Killeen's roots are tied to the railroad. Killeen was officially formed May 15, 1882, after the first train stopped in town. Decades later, during World War II, Camp Hood formed in 1942. By 1950, the population had grown to 7,045.The Woodlands, TX. City. Population: 114,532. Texas has always remained an attractive state for reasons that include good climate, low state taxes, affordable housing, exciting cities and plenty to do.Li...See full list on forbes.com McKinney is a historic town that has withstood the test of time. Founded in 1839, McKinney served as the commercial center and county seat for Collin County. Located 30 miles north of Dallas, the city of 200,000 offers residents an engaging mix of historic landmarks, boutique shopping, and farm-to-table cuisine.#1 Best Suburbs to Live in Texas.Cinco Ranch.
